## Deploying the Gatewick Proctor Queue

Deploys are pretty painless: push to main, wait for the pipeline, then watch the queue drain dashboard for five minutes. If candidates pile up mid-exam, roll back first and ask questions later — the queue replays safely. Everything the workers care about lives in one config block, shown here for reference.

settings of bafof-yagef:
JOROX_PIN=8740
JOROX_TENANT=pelox
JOROX_METRICS_HOST=metrics.jorox.qorvelworks.internal
JOROX_SEAL=seal_c78f63c1
JOROX_STANDBY_TEAM=norax

Subject: CSV import wizard — release handover

Hi Priya,

Welcome aboard! You're inheriting releases for Gridloader's CSV import wizard. It ships weekly; the tricky part is the column-mapping migration, which needs a manual smoke test on the staging tenant before promoting. Checklist lives in the runbook under "import-wizard." Deploys are gated on artifact signatures, so you'll need the signing key from day one — I've included it below.

Thanks,
Olen

deploy key for yajop-fahop: bky3_h1v

Welcome to the rotation for Matchforge. Most pages trace back to garbage-collection pauses in the matcher tier; pauses over two seconds stall the pairing queue and trip the latency alarm. No sensitive data is exposed during pauses — requests queue, nothing drops. Heap tuning history, pause dashboards, and escalation steps are documented on the internal runtime page.

operations page: https://confluence.nelvroworks.example/dash/spaces/board/job/pipeline/issue/spaces/b9c0f0fbc164027c4eb481af

This fires when the Lanyard gateway detects that consecutive pages of a collection endpoint return overlapping or missing records, usually because a writer mutated the underlying sort key mid-scan. For new team members: this is not a data-loss event, but it breaks client integrations at Tarncliff partners, so treat it as high priority during business hours. Check the cursor-consistency job first, then the replica lag panel. The triage checklist and known offending endpoints are documented on the internal page.

wiki page, fahaf-yagag: https://confluence.qorvellabs.internal/pages/display/pages/display